titleOfInvention Dye borate photoinitiator and photo-setting composition containing the same
abstract NEW MATERIAL: A borate anion complex represented by formula Y 1 and Y 2 are each O, S, selenium, vinyl, >C(CH 3 ) 2 or N-R 7 ; n is 0 or 1-3; R 1 and R 2 are each alkyl and at least one of them is long chain alkyl having at least 8 C-atoms; R 3 -R 6 are alkyl, aryl, aralkyl, alkaryl, alkenyl, alkynyl, an alicyclic group, a heterocyclic group or an allyl group; and R 7 is short chain alkyl]. n USE: This new material is useful as a photoinitiator or a component of a photo- setting compsn. and shows high-order solubility in a usual monomer and a photoinitiator of a new kind imparting a high membrane forming speed. n PROCESS: The compd. represented by the formula is produced by using the method described in US Patent 4772530 and 4772541. The photosetting compsn. is pref. used by microencapsulation. n COPYRIGHT: (C)1991,JPO
